Boston Calling Posts September Festival Schedule

Hey festival lovers: The highly anticipated schedule for the fall edition of Boston Calling has been posted.
The weekend-long (Sept. 5-7) music and arts festival will kick off Friday on City Hall Plaza at 6:45 p.m. with a performance by Future Islands on the JetBlue Stage. Neutral Milk Hotel (8:00, JetBlue Stage) and The National (9:30, JetBlue Stage) will round out the Sept. 5 lineup.
Saturday’s performances start at 1:05 p.m. with the Sonicbids winner on the Capital One 360 Red Stage, and wraps up with Girl Talk (7:10, JetBlue Stage), Lorde (8:15, Capital One 360 Red Stage), and Childish Gambino (9:30, JetBlue Stage).
Sunday’s performances also start at 1:05 p.m. with Gentlemen Hall (Capital One 360 Red Stage), before Spoon (7:10, JetBlue Stage), The Replacements (8:15, Capital One 360 Stage), and Nas x The Roots (9:20, JetBlue Stage) wrap things up.
